/*
 * MAX_RENDER_PASSES caps the number of transform passes in the
 * Inkbarrel markdown pipeline. Each pass may expand shortcodes,
 * which can themselves emit markdown, so an unbounded loop is
 * possible with a pathological plugin. Three passes covers every
 * known legitimate nesting case; anything deeper aborts the render
 * and logs a diagnostic for the weekly sync. Do not raise this
 * without a fuzz run against the shortcode corpus. The constant
 * was validated under the build identified just below.
 */

trace token, fafog-kageg: htk4_98e6

Handover — Vexler partner SFTP drop

Ownership moves to you today. Drop runs hourly from Vexler's end into the intake bucket via the relay host. Watch for zero-byte files; their exporter flakes on Mondays. Creds live in the ops vault, path noted in the runbook. Vault auto-seals after 48h idle. Support escalations go to the on-call rotation, not me. If the vault is sealed when you need it, unseal with the recovery passphrase below.

recovery phrase for tadug-fafof: zorwyn-kasion

Ticket: Reset flow revamp — hold for verification

The new password reset flow in Brindlecore merged yesterday, but the rate limiter config was not updated to match the shorter token lifetime. Without the fix, users retrying quickly hit a false lockout. Patch is attached and passing on staging. Release manager: please hold the cut until this lands. The candidate build that includes the patch is referenced by the token below.

pipeline stamp: htk31_f769b577b3028a4e9958e5bb8d1259a

## Service Accounts — StormFan Alert Fan-Out

The fan-out worker authenticates to the internal dispatch tier using the svc-stormfan account. Rotate quarterly; scopes are limited to publish-only on alert topics. If deliveries stall during your shift, verify the worker is using the current credential, reproduced below for reference.

API key for kaweg-hahif: kto4_rAjZ